Key Pending Matters

🏠 Housing

- Affordable Housing resolve (2024 & 2025) - Affordable Housing Trust Fund

📋 Ordinance

- Citywide zoning code review - Potential adoption of a Stretch Energy Code - Creation of a Congregate Over-55 Housing Overlay District - Amendments to codes covering sex offenders and animals - Establishment of a Public Arts Commission - Traffic matters: Stop signs and parking restrictions on various streets

🔍 Oversight

- Affordable Housing reviews - Wildfire Preparedness resolve - Accounting & Purchasing Review

🔧 Public Works

- Utility grant of location for Mass Electric/Verizon on Spear Street
